Coverage SectionThe Consumer Expenditure Survey Coverage Section is used by the field representative to provide information on housing units that were selected into the sample but not interviewed. * What type of non-interview do you have? Type A = No one home, temporarily absent, or refusal Type B = Vacant, under construction, occupied by persons with URE Type C = Demolished, house moved, merged, condemned, located on base, household moved * Enter TYPE A noninterview * Specify other TYPE A [enter text] _____________ * Enter type of refusal * Specify type of refusal [enter text] _____________ * Enter TYPE B noninterview
